Hoping someone can help - here's the problem:

I have successfully paired my Droid Bionic (and uploaded all my contacts) to the COMAND system. The phone dials through the system and the phone rings through the system. But, there is absolutely no sound. I have adjusted all of the volume controls up (in the phone settings menu and using the knob on the front of the system). I get plenty of volume via the radio, Ipod and all other media sources.

In addition, the microphone is not working. When I attempt to do a voice initialization, the system cannot hear me. And, when I try to speak through someone on the phone when connected to the system, there is no sound (ie no one can hear me).

This sounds like it could be a blown fuse or a loose wire or a disconnected wire. I did a system reset on the COMAND and it did not help. I also ran the diagnostics and everything seemed to check out.

Trying to avoid the dealer if I can. Any ideas/suggestions as to what might be wrong?

Thanks everyone for the suggestions. Tried three different phones (another Droid, a Blackberry and an iphone) and in all trials I cannot hear the caller through the car speakers and they cannot hear me.

Sounds like something specific to the microphone/cell phone speaker is disconnected somewhere - all of the volume levels are up and the fact that the radio, ipod and nav can all be heard through the speakers really narrows this down.

Any MB service techs out there that have any thoughts on what this might be?

Did you try to reset the system? if not push the on off button on the radio and hold for 5-10 seconds for a reset. But first check the mute button on your steering wheel or on the radio control panel.

You're not alone here. In my GLK350 and my partners E350 class both went sound dead but only when the phone was actively being used. The radio/CD was fine. After an embarrassing (for the dealer) visit to fix the situation, it appears when you make or receive a call, there is a menu option to silence the call in both our bottom right corners of the screen. It took 1 hour to find this menu to turn just this on or off. For some reason MB decided the term "Mute on/Mute off" did not make sense. Anyway 2 clicks later the sound was back. It's really easy to activate mute with just a tap of the command wheel. And it only works for cellular opposed to the entire system mute on the steering wheel. Bah humbug logic Germans!
